Autumn Days = 70's Style

Autumn is finally starting to creep in here with cooler nights, bright and breezy days so my thoughts turn to "what do I wear now?" When I picture autumn days I always see the best of the glamorous 70's, cosy knits, snug blazers and sweeping capes all in those wonderful autumnal colours of berry, rust and deep greens. So I was very happy to find these photos over at Fashion Gone Rogue, of a shoot from Elle Belgium that made all my ideas comes to life, I feel inspired, do you?

These colours are amazing and that knitted cape is one of the best I have ever seen.

Neutrals always look better next to some colour.

Play with cosy textures to add depth to your layers.

Keep shapes slim and add a skinny belt for definition.

Instead on a woolly hat, try a patterned silk scarf with a strong colour palette.

And never forget your accessories, they can change the look of any outfit from dull to fabulous.
